6. Weighing Children and Adolescents: Procedures


For all children, there is a need to respect privacy. Privacy includes where the measurements are taken, clothing removal, provision of gowns, describing the measuring process, and interpreting the numbers.

The child or adolescent is weighed wearing only lightweight undergarments, or gown. The child or adolescent stands on the center of the platform of the scale.

The weight of the individual is recorded to the nearest 0.01 kg or 1/2 oz.
